Anyone using Infinity products??
After I started the "post install amp" thread a couple of days ago, my Apline MRVF400 just aint cutting it. It worked fine 5 years ago(its been sitting on my garage for 5 years after my 93 camaro got totaled). Its rated at 60w x4 RMS but just doesnt seem to have any power. It sounds more like a 25W x4 cheapo amp. I saw the new Infinity 7540a rated at a CEa2006 compliant rating of 111w x 4 @ 4 ohms! Yikes. Thats about the most powerful 4 channel amp ive ever seen under $300 bucks. Just wondering if anyone else has used Infinity car stuff, thanks.
